Automotive Textiles Market Segmentation:

Product Segment Analysis

Woven segment is poised to account for more than 40% automotive textiles market share by the end of 2035. Plain woven fabrics are made from air-jet textured and spun polyester yarns, impacting the automotive textiles landscape. Moreover, non-woven is also witnessing a boost as this product is easily moldable, abrasion resistant, readily sewn, seamed, flame resistant, coated, thermal protection, superior strength, and weight, easily shape retention, acoustic insulation, dyed and laminated, fireproof insulation, and air filtration. Growth in this sector will fuel the high performance insulation material value in the near future.

Application Segment Analysis

In automotive textiles market, upholstery segment is estimated to register lucrative growth through 2035. Ongoing development of upholstery polyester and the entrance of emerging players are aiding segment proliferation. In 2022, the Swedish School of Textiles knitting lab and advanced EV manufacturer Polestar collaborated to launch upholstery textiles for the Polestar 4 electric SUV coupe. Automobile manufacturing companies are fostering sustainability and reduction in carbon footprint. For instance, in June 2023, Toyota the C-HR as a part of Europe's C-segment SUVs. Compared to its predecessor, the Toyota C-HR new car uses recycled plastics in more than 100 different components. The materials include an innovative seat upholstery fabric made from recycled PET bottles.

In the year 2026, the industry size of automotive textiles is estimated at USD 33.88 billion.

The global automotive textiles market size was more than USD 32.87 billion in 2025 and is anticipated to grow at a CAGR of more than 3.4%, reaching USD 45.92 billion revenue by 2035.

Asia Pacific automotive textiles market will dominate around 48% share by 2035, driven by demographic dividends and fast economic growth boosting auto sales.

Key players in the market include Supima, Acme Mills, Aunde SA, International Textile Ltd., Borgers AG, Dupont, Autotech Nonwovens, ASGLAWO Technofibre GmbH, Sage Automotive Interiors Inc.
